What is the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form?
The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form is a crucial document utilized by healthcare providers involved in the QUEST program. This form serves to disclose essential information regarding ownership and managing interests to HMSA.
Disclosing accurate details is significant as it ensures compliance within the healthcare system, thereby promoting transparency and accountability among providers. It allows HMSA to verify that no excluded persons are affiliated with the entities submitting this form.

Key Features of the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form
The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form contains essential components necessary for compliance. Required fields include crucial personal information such as names, addresses, dates of birth, and Social Security numbers of owners and managing employees.
Additionally, it mandates an annual submission deadline, which is vital for meeting ongoing compliance obligations. Failing to submit on time may lead to administrative repercussions.

Who needs to submit the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form?
The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form must be submitted by healthcare providers participating in the QUEST program to disclose ownership and management information.
What is the submission deadline for this form?
The completed Hawaii Med-QUEST Disclosure Form must be submitted annually by July 31 to ensure compliance with HMSA requirements.
